A pair of double-headed retaining ring pliers, including handles, a left arm, and a right arm. Middle parts of the left arm and the right arm are hingedly connected by a hinge axle. The handles are divided into a left handle and a right handle. The handles are flipped to enable the retaining ring pliers to have two working states: One is used for installing an outer retaining ring, and the other is used for installing an inner retaining ring. In addition, the left arm and the right arm can be returned by a return spring.

DESCRIPTION OF THE EMBODIMENTS
[0026] This embodiment relates to a pair of double-headed retaining ring pliers, as shown in
[0027] A first left head 8 and a second left head 9 are respectively arranged at two end portions of the left arm, the left arm is divided into two sections, one section from the hinge point to the first left head 8 is noted as a first left arm 3, and the other section from the hinge point to the second left head 9 is noted as a second left arm 4. Likewise, a first right head 11 and a second right head 12 are respectively arranged at two end portions of the right arm, the right arm is divided into two sections, one section from the hinge point to the first right head 11 is noted as a first right arm 5, and the other section from the hinge point to the second right head 12 is noted as a second right arm 6.
[0028] The handles include a left handle 1 and a right handle 2. An end portion of the left handle 1 is hingedly connected to an end portion of the right handle 2 by the hinge axle 7. To prevent slippage in use, preferably anti-slip patterns are arranged on grips of the handles, the anti-slip patterns may be arranged directly on the handles, or plastic sleeves with anti-slip patterns may be sleeved over the handles.
[0029] A left support arm 15 is arranged on the first left arm 3, the left support arm 15 extends from the first left arm 3 in a direction away from the first right arm 5, and an angle between the left support arm 15 and the first left arm 3 is less than 90?, most preferably, ranges from 30? to 60?. A too large or too small angle is convenient for subsequent operations of flipping the handles. A right support arm 16 is arranged on the first right arm 5, the right support arm 16 extends from the first right arm 5 in a direction away from the first left arm 3, and an angle between the right support arm 16 and the first right arm 5 is less than 90?. Similarly, most preferably, the angle ranges from 30? to 60?. Apparently, most preferably, the two angles are kept consistent.
[0030] A left drive lever 17 is arranged on the left handle 1, a first left drive position 18 cooperating with the left drive lever 17 is arranged on the second left arm 4, and a second left drive position 19 cooperating with the left drive lever 17 is arranged on the left support arm 16. A right drive lever 20 is arranged on the right handle 2, a first right drive position 21 cooperating with the right drive lever 20 is arranged on the second right arm 6, and a second right drive position 22 cooperating with the right drive lever 20 is arranged on the left support arm 15. The left drive lever 17 and the right drive lever 20 may be protruding blocks or similar protruding rod-like objects fixedly connected to the left handle 1 and the right handle 2.
